I updated CentOS 7 x86_64 and when I want to boot via new kernel then CentOS crashed and can't boot. I attached two images.

Re: CentOS crashed after update.
Your latest kernel doesn't have an initramfs file in /boot. Pick the older kernel then use yum reinstall on the latest kernel which will recreate it.
